Description
Product Development
- Lead the mechanical design and development of adhesive dispensing systems and subsystems.
- Design and optimize sheet metal components, castings, machined parts, and product assemblies.
- Develop 3D models, engineering drawings, specifications, and technical documentation using SolidWorks & CAD tools.
- Support the complete product development lifecycle, including concept generation, prototyping, validation, and product launch.
- Collaborate closely with Electrical, Manufacturing, Quality, and Product Management teams to ensure robust product solutions.
- Drive continuous product improvements related to performance, reliability, manufacturability, cost, and customer experience.
Product Integration & Testing
- Coordinate mechanical system integration activities and support prototype assembly.
- Conduct design verification and validation testing.
- Analyze test results and implement design improvements.
- Support laboratory testing and product performance evaluations.
- Participate in design reviews and risk assessments.
Technical Support
- Provide technical support to Sales, Service, and Manufacturing teams.
- Diagnose and troubleshoot mechanical issues in field and production environments.
- Perform root cause analysis and develop effective corrective actions.
- Support customer-specific applications and customized product solutions as required.
Compliance & Documentation
- Prepare and maintain engineering documentation, specifications, and technical reports.
- Support CE certification activities and regulatory compliance requirements.
- Contribute to product safety reviews and engineering change processes.
- Ensure compliance with applicable engineering standards and company procedures.
Additional Responsibilities
- Participate in special engineering projects and cross-functional initiatives.
- Support product cost-reduction, quality improvement, and value-engineering efforts.
- Assist in supplier technical discussions and component evaluations when required.
Education
- Bachelor’s degree in Mechanical Engineering, Product Design Engineering, Mechatronics Engineering, or a related discipline.
Experience
- Minimum 5 years of experience in mechanical design and product development.
- Experience designing industrial equipment, machinery, instruments, or automation systems is preferred.
- Experience with product development in a multinational company environment is advantageous.
- Experience working through all stages of the product development process, from concept to production.
Required
- Strong mechanical design and product development background.
- Proficiency with: SolidWorks & AutoCAD
- Experience designing: Sheet metal components and assemblies; Cast parts and housings; Mechanical systems and equipment structures.
- Ability to create and interpret engineering drawings and technical specifications.
- Knowledge of manufacturing processes, including sheet metal fabrication, machining, welding, and casting.
- Strong analytical and troubleshooting capabilities.
- Ability to read and prepare technical documentation in English.
Preferred
- Experience with adhesive dispensing systems, fluid handling equipment, or industrial machinery.
- Familiarity with Design for Manufacturing (DFM) and Design for Assembly (DFA) principles.
- Experience supporting CE certification and product compliance activities.
- Experience using SAP C4C or other ERP/CRM systems.
- Understanding of finite element analysis (FEA) and mechanical simulation tools.
